117.info
人生若只如初见

merge oracle如何处理大量数据

在Oracle数据库中处理大量数据时,可以使用以下方法来优化性能和处理大量数据:

  1. 使用索引:创建适当的索引可以提高查询性能和加快数据访问速度。

  2. 使用分区表:将数据分散存储在多个分区中,可以减少查询时间和优化性能。

  3. 使用并行处理:使用Oracle并行处理功能可以并行执行查询和数据操作,加快处理大量数据的速度。

  4. 使用分批处理:将大量数据分成小批处理,逐步处理数据,避免一次性处理大量数据导致性能下降。

  5. 使用优化器统计信息:确保数据库中的统计信息是最新的,可以帮助优化器生成最佳执行计划,提高查询效率。

  6. 使用适当的数据类型和索引策略:选择合适的数据类型和索引策略可以提高数据检索和操作的效率。

  7. 使用合适的缓存机制:使用合适的缓存机制可以减少IO操作,提高数据访问速度。

总的来说,合理设计数据库结构,使用合适的索引和优化器统计信息,以及利用Oracle的并行处理功能,可以有效处理大量数据并提高性能。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e101AzsIAgFRAFU.html

推荐文章

  • 如何优化Oracle进程

    优化Oracle进程可以通过以下几种方法来实现: 调整内存设置:通过调整共享池、缓冲池和PGA等内存设置来提高Oracle进程的性能。可以根据实际需求和服务器资源来调...

  • Oracle进程能提升性能吗

    是的,Oracle进程可以提升性能。通过优化Oracle进程的配置和调整,可以提高数据库的性能和响应速度。例如,可以调整Oracle实例的内存分配、使用适当的索引、优化...

  • 为什么Oracle进程很重要

    Oracle进程在数据库系统中扮演着非常重要的角色,主要原因包括: 数据访问控制:Oracle进程负责处理用户和应用程序的数据请求,确保只有经过授权的用户可以访问数...

  • Oracle进程管理你知道吗

    Oracle进程管理是指Oracle数据库中各种进程的管理和监控。Oracle数据库中有多种类型的进程,如后台进程、前台进程、用户进程等。
    后台进程是Oracle数据库自...

  • 如何优化merge oracle操作

    以下是一些建议来优化merge操作: 索引优化:确保表中的所有列都有适当的索引,特别是在merge操作的条件列和更新列上创建索引可以帮助提高性能。 使用合适的条件...

  • merge oracle使用中的常见问题

    ORA-00904: Invalid identifier This error occurs when a column name specified in a SQL statement is invalid or misspelled. To resolve this issue, doubl...

  • merge oracle在性能上的优势

    Oracle数据库在性能上的优势主要体现在以下几个方面: 数据处理能力强:Oracle数据库在处理大量数据时具有较高的性能表现,能够支持高并发的数据操作,保证系统的...

  • merge oracle支持哪些数据类型

    在Oracle数据库中,支持的数据类型包括: 数值型数据类型:NUMBER、FLOAT、REAL、DECIMAL、INTEGER等
    字符型数据类型:CHAR、VARCHAR2、NCHAR、NVARCHAR2、...